Is it the same bus all the way ? i.e. one ticket and approx how much ?

Delays at border crossings, particularly Lao Bao ?

I did it the other direction--Hue to Mukdahan.

One bus from Hue to Savannakhet: About $25 USD. Stayed overnight in Savannakhet and took local bus across bridge into Mukdahan.

About 15-20 minute delay at Lao Bao while some passengers obtained visa-on-arrival to go into Laos. Always better to get your visas ahead of time at a consulate or embassy here, if required.
